Specializations
Growth Disorders
The investigator specializes in treating skeletal growth disorders, with particular emphasis on achondroplasia and hypochondroplasia. Their research encompasses innovative therapeutic approaches for improving growth outcomes in pediatric patients with these conditions.
- Growth velocity assessment
- Skeletal development monitoring
- Long-term growth management
Their work focuses on evaluating novel therapeutic agents that target the underlying mechanisms of skeletal growth disorders.
Bone Disorders
The investigator conducts research in genetic bone disorders, particularly focusing on osteogenesis imperfecta. Their expertise includes evaluating treatments aimed at reducing fracture rates and improving bone strength in patients with brittle bone syndrome.
- Bone strength assessment
- Fracture prevention strategies
- Genetic bone disease management
Their research aims to advance therapeutic options for patients with inherited bone disorders.
Endocrine Disorders
The investigator specializes in pediatric endocrine disorders, with particular expertise in congenital adrenal hyperplasia. Their research involves evaluating treatments that regulate adrenal steroid levels in affected patients.
- Adrenal function regulation
- Hormonal therapy optimization
- Pediatric endocrine care
Their work encompasses the development of targeted therapies for hormonal disorders affecting pediatric populations.
